Apgar score
An Apgar score for infants is a quick check of the infant's health. It is given in less than one minute after birth or even in the event of being revived. It's a useful option for parents as well as healthcare personnel alike. However, it should not be used to substitute for medical assistance. Apgar scores are determined by the aggregate of several factors. A one with a low Apgar score means an infant is at the risk of medical intervention, but it is not necessarily signalling an underlying medical issue. In fact, many babies are born with an unsatisfactory Apgar score, while being well-behaved. The doctor will inform you why you should be concerned be aware that this score does not constitute an accurate measure of health and behavior or personality.

Health Conditions
Early life events can impact the physiology of a person and make them more susceptible to illness. One important component of these "programmed consequences" is nutrition at an early age. The study of the developmental origins of Health and Disease (DOHAD) deals with this issue. In addition to the standard diseases that are inherited the non-genetic elements can affect a child's growth. Early in medical history, diarrhoea or tuberculosis was a major killers in children. Victorians were unaware of the fact of the fact that bovine tuberculosis was an epidemic that killed millions of people, particularly children. This airborne disease thrives when there is a lot of people living in the same space and is usually transmitted via milk. Before 1930, milk related disease was responsible to around 30 percent of tuberculosis fatalities among infants.
